I think the only remaining problem for this logo is that both sets of teeth are visible. The updated teeth are a small improvement, but he still has three white blocky areas stacked on top of eachother (top teeth - sword - bottom teeth). It's just too many consecutive similar shapes in a row. If you eliminate the bottom teeth square, just like the real logo, then this would be fantastic.

One last thing, I think the wink is a unique quality that could also help, but I know some people love the wink and others hate it, so it's up to your preference.
